Direct Digital Amplifiers
Yes- class D amps operate in the analog domain. The 'D' is used because A, B and C were taken.If you run a DAC directly into any traditional amplifier, the signal chain is actually simpler. Cass D amplifiers have considerably more processing to ma...

Tube amp terminology
Very few phono preamps are push-pull. A better term would be balanced.Triode- a tube with three elements. The most linear form of amplification known.Tetrode- a tube with 4 elements. Used for power output. EL34 is an examplePentode- five elements....
